Vehicle Ad hoc Networks (VANET) emerged as a subset of the Mobile Ad hoc Network (MANET) application; it is considered to be a substantial approach to the Intelligent Transportation System (ITS). VANETs were introduced to support drivers and improve safety issues and driving comfort, as a step towards constructing a safer, cleaner and more intelligent environment. VANET has some unique characteristics compared to MANET; specifically it includes high mobility and constrained patterns restricted by roads. Many challenges have emerged in VANET, encouraging researchers to investigate their research in an attempt to meet these challenges. Routing protocol issues are considered to be a critical dilemma that needs to be tackled in VANET, particularly in a sparse environment. This book introduces an efficient routing mechanism that impacts on enhancing network performance in terms of disseminating messages to a desired destination, balancing the overhead on the network and increasing the ratio of packet delivery with a reduced time delay. Moreover this book presents an On Board Unit (OBU) architecture for sending HELLO beacon messages adaptively in VANET based on the context aware system.
